首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
Selenium实战指南
柒柒7
创建于2022-10-07
订阅专栏
Selenium实战指南记录:1、通过Element UI的组件库联系各类组件的操作方式;2、通过真实网站了解selenium实战方案
等 4 人订阅
共12篇文章
创建于2022-10-07
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
Selenium Grid4 使用指南(三)
上面两节介绍了Selenium Grid4的三种使用方式,本章来使用Docker运行Selenium Grid4的hub/node。
Selenium Grid4 使用指南(二)
上章《Selenium Grid4 使用指南(一)》已经介绍了两种运行方式,standalone和hub/node,今天介绍Selenium Grid4提供的另外一种完全分布式的用法。
Selenium Grid4 使用指南(一)
Selenium Grid 允许通过将客户端发送的命令路由到远程浏览器实例来在远程机器上执行 WebDriver 脚本。
09 selenium中的等待机制
本章来介绍selenium开发过程中用到的最多的几种等待方式,因为页面的加载是需要时间的,所以为了脚本的稳定性,通常都需要设置等待时间。目前主要有三种等待方式,强制等待、隐式等待和显式等待。
08 selenium操作浏览器原理解析+演示
在《01 selenium环境搭建》中就已经说到,selenium运行的原理就是通过chromedriver操作浏览器),那究竟是如何完成的呢?本章就给大家揭开它的神秘面纱。
07 selenium操作已经打开的浏览器
前面的章节,所有示例都是通过webdriver打开一个新的浏览器,但是在有些情况下,我们希望能够直接操作已经打开的浏览器。
06 DriverManager源码解析+问题解决方案
解决部分Chrome版本号,DriverManager驱动管理工具找不到对应驱动的问题,含源码解析。
05 selenium网页截长图(无头浏览器)
上节以ElementUI网页为例,演示了如何进行网页滚动截图;本节提供另外一种方案,使用无头浏览器实现网页截长图。
04 selenium网页截长图(滚动截图+拼接)
截图只截了当前窗口,所以下面的元素无法完整截图,同样,如果页面下方还有获取的元素,同样在截图中无法看见,因此这里可以进行进一步优化,即网页滚动截图。
03 selenium获取超链接元素
上节通过ElementUI提供的「基础用法」的按钮练习了三种获取元素的方式,今天通过ElementUI提供的超链接元素练习其他获取元素的方式。
02 selenium获取按钮元素
上章已经成功运行了一个demo,本章开始进入实战环节,任务是通过多种方式获取到「基础用法」中的4个【Success】按钮。
01 selenium环境搭建(python版)
「selenium实战专栏」将记录selenium实战(Python版)过程,以及各类问题的解决方案。